HATTIESBURG, Miss. – The Alcorn State University men's tennis program will play a pair of matches Saturday when it takes on Florida A&M at 11 a.m. and Southern Miss at 2 p.m. at the Southern Miss Tennis Facility.
Â
The match against FAMU (0-3) will count as a neutral court contest, while the Southern Miss (0-0) bout is a road match.
Â
Alcorn (0-6) has played a challenging schedule to begin 2017. The Braves started out with a doubleheader against defending Southland Conference champion Lamar and followed it up with a doubleheader vs. a 17-11 UL-Lafayette program from last year and another doubleheader against a Tulane team that advanced to the second round of the 2016 NCAA Tournament.
Â
Sophomore
Nuno Rocha posted a pair of wins, one in each singles and doubles. He teamed with junior
Nischay Rawal to defeat ULL's Eric Perez and Elio Lago 6-2 at the No. 2 spot.
Â
FAMU opened its season last weekend at the Florida State Tournament in Tallahassee, Florida where it fell to the Seminoles, Florida Gulf Coast and Georgia Southern.
Â
The Rattlers made it to the finals of the MEAC Championships last season before losing to South Carolina State. They brought back three starters including their No. 1 and No. 2 singles players Courage Okungbowa and Karlyn Small.
Â
Southern Miss will play its season-opener this weekend. It finished 16-8 overall last year and 3-2 against Conference USA foes. The Golden Eagles returned five starters from that squad.
Â
The Alcorn women's program will kick-off the 2017 season on Friday, Feb. 3 at the University of New Orleans at 1 p.m.
